Positivity thread!

Hi everyone, I know that it just isn't possible to stay positive all the time in the face of MS, and we shouldn't be expected to, sometimes it's tough and we just need to let ourselves feel how we do in that moment. BUT I would really love it if from time to time we could all share something that we are proud of, or something that happened to make us feel good, even something small. For example, mine is that the other day I was feeling very run down and tired, but had planned to meet up with some friends that I hadn't seen in some time for a "paint night" where they teach you to do a simple painting all together. I didn't think I could do it, but I wanted to try and pushed myself to get out and ended up having a really nice time, and even thought I was exhausted when I got home, I was so glad I tried! Is there anything you can share that made you feel proud, or positive in some way?
